I can recall people getting their ears pierced with a needle and thread. The way your ear would be numbed before the dastardly deed would be with a cube of ice not very conventional but popular at the time none the less. Then the needle would be pulled painfully through the ear much to the poor victims shock and dismay the cube of ice anesthetic wore off all the soon. Once the needle was pulled completely through the now pulsating blood red mangled ear the thread was leaf behind and tied in a knot. The professional instructions from the ear expert was to then pull the thread back and forth as many times as possible to keep the newly butchered hole open for the future beautiful new earring once the expert said the ear was ready. In most cases the ear expert would not declare the ear ready for an earring until the drainage slowed nearly to none at all, better known as the crusty gunk on the string. Now once you were lucky enough to be declared crusty gunk free you could then remove the string. Once your string was now gone, in most cases two weeks later you could have a beautiful new pair of earrings.

Clip on earrings were for those people to chicken to brave the needle treatment.
Thread earrings are not the kind of thread I told you about above thankfully this one is a lot more attractive. This is metal not thread and looks a lot better then the previously mentioned thread.
Post or Stud is a straight metal post with a stone, pearl or fake jewl to decorate the end that is visable in front.
French wire or Hook earrings are designed without a back that closes basically they just as they are called hook into your ear.
Hoop is called a hoop because it has a cirle circle or hoop look. The hoop has a closure to secure the earring in your ear.
Gauge is a thick earring that makes the hole bigger then the typical pierced ear size. The Gauge earrings can be very small or very large depending on what size of Gauge you chose to put in your ear.
Fake Gauges come in handy when you realize that the one main thing about using a Gauge is that once you make the hole bigger the hole will stay bigger. There is no way to make the hole smaller this is where a Fake Gauge comes in handy. The hole is not bigger but you get the same look as if it was.
Plug is another type of earring that like the Gauge makes the hole bigger. The difference between the Gauge and the Plug is that the Gauge has a tail the Plug as it sounds is a small plug so to speak.
Fake Plug. As you may have guessed there are Fake Plugs as well. The Fake Plug serves the same purpose as the Fake Gauge so the hole is not made larger because as you know the hole can not be made smaller only larger.

Questions surround earrings that Ky. Historical Society says belonged to Mary Todd Lincoln
- Some doubts about earrings tied to Mrs. LincolnSeattle Times2 days ago
The Kentucky Historical Society has been displaying and publicizing a pair of earrings as having belonged to Mary Todd Lincoln, but others aren't as sure about their authenticity.
